Word Study · Strong's H2786 · Hebrew
חָרַק
charaq
khaw-rak'
Strong's 1890 spelling: châraq
“to grate the teeth”
Strong's Dictionary · 1890 · public domain
to grate the teeth
Rendered in the KJV as
gnash.

Psalms3 occurrences
- Psalms 35:16חָרֹ֖קcharokverb · simple (qal), infinitive absoluteLike godless jesters at a feast, they gnashed their teeth at me.here: they gnashed
- Psalms 37:12וְחֹרֵ֖קvechorekconjunction (“and”) + verb · simple (qal), participle (“the one who…”) · masculine singularThe wicked scheme against the righteous and gnash their teeth at them,here: and [is] gnashing
- Psalms 112:10יַחֲרֹ֣קyacharokverb · simple (qal), ongoing or future action · 3rd person masculine singularThe wicked man will see and be grieved; he will gnash his teeth and waste away; the desires of the wicked will perish.here: he will gnash
